Boring, predictable, by the numbers Victorian romance about a girl betrothed as a baby to an Italian count, whom she meets at 17 with the usual I-hate-him-but-I-want-him reaction. Hero Max is the usual completely perfect sex machine. I stopped really reading about 1/3 of the way through and spot-read some of the rest of it. This book could be a lesson in how to do dull & trite books to fill a publisher's schedule. It makes me wonder why so many good romance authors can't find a new publisher yet stuff like this gets published.

Victorian that feels more like Regency -- about a headstrong, rebellious young girl who grows up knowing that she belongs to a happy family -- brother, mother & father.
She discovers that the truth is something different -- her mother is her aunt and she is betrothed to a count from Italy -- who has come to get her so they can be married.
